JPMorgan Files Trademark for JPMD Crypto Platform Amid Growing Blockchain Push

JPMorgan Files Trademark for JPMD Crypto Platform Amid Growing Blockchain Push.

JPMorgan Chase, the largest U.S. bank by assets, has filed a trademark application for a new crypto-focused platform named JPMD, signaling deeper involvement in digital assets. The application, submitted to the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office, outlines services including digital asset trading, exchange, transfers, payments, and issuance—suggesting a comprehensive platform for blockchain-based financial services.

This move aligns with a broader trend among traditional financial institutions entering the crypto space through tokenization, stablecoins, and blockchain infrastructure. JPMorgan, which already operates its proprietary blockchain network Kynexis processing over $2 billion in daily volume, appears to be doubling down on its digital asset strategy.

The bank's pivot is notable given CEO Jamie Dimon's historical criticism of cryptocurrencies. However, in a recent statement, Dimon acknowledged that JPMorgan will now allow clients to access bitcoin investments. The bank has also started accepting bitcoin ETFs as loan collateral, reflecting a growing institutional embrace of crypto assets.

Reports have also linked JPMorgan to discussions with U.S. banks on launching a regulated stablecoin. Combined with the JPMD trademark filing, these developments indicate a strategic shift toward integrating digital assets more deeply into the bank’s offerings.

JPMorgan’s expanding crypto infrastructure follows industry momentum toward on-chain finance, as asset managers roll out crypto investment products and explore tokenized asset platforms. The JPMD brand could become a central pillar in JPMorgan’s future blockchain and Web3 initiatives.

As regulatory clarity improves and institutional demand rises, JPMorgan’s latest filing highlights the accelerating race among Wall Street giants to capture market share in the evolving digital finance ecosystem.
